Program Overview

Ayat Arabic Communication is for learners who have a basic reading foundation and want to understand and use more Arabic. The program develops vocabulary, sentence formation, listening, reading and guided speaking together.

Rather than studying isolated word lists, students meet vocabulary inside useful themes and sentence patterns. Previously learned language is recycled so that comprehension and communication become progressively more natural.

Progress & Assessment

Progress is checked through comprehension and use, not only vocabulary recall. Students are asked to recognize language in new examples and use familiar structures in different situations.

The teacher can place additional emphasis on speaking, reading or comprehension according to the learner’s goals while maintaining a balanced language foundation.
